TEMPORARY table causes a.v. on server |

Tiago Ameller | This script has two issues:
/* Export today's server log to csv */ SCRIPT () BEGIN EXECUTE IMMEDIATE ' CREATE TEMPORARY TABLE TODAYS_LOG AS SELECT "LOGTIMESTAMP", "USER", "CATEGORY", "FUNCTION", "DESCRIPTION" FROM CONFIGURATION.LOGEVENTS WHERE LOGTIMESTAMP BETWEEN CURRENT_DATE AND CURRENT_DATE + INTERVAL "1" DAY WITH DATA'; EXECUTE IMMEDIATE 'EXPORT TEMPORARY TABLE TODAYS_LOG TO "TODAYS_LOG.CSV" IN STORE CLIENTS DELIMITER CHAR '';'' DATE FORMAT ''DD/MM/YYYY'' TIME FORMAT ''HH:MM:SS'' DECIMAL CHAR '','' INCLUDE HEADERS'; END 1. Server raises: ElevateDB Error #900 An error occurred with the statement at line 7 and column 1 (Access violation at address 00000000. Write of address 00000000) 2. How to reach created TEMPORARY TABLE? EXPORT TEMPORARY TABLE TODAYS_LOG TO ... is not correct 3. How to delete it when script terminates? In 18/dec/2008 Tim wrote "2.03 is going to finally have a catalog table for temporary tables, and then I can see about adding them as a separate list in the EDB Manager." Some times I need an middle table in a two pass process as described. Temporary tables are a good solution due no in_memory database is needed. |

Fernando Dias Team Elevate | Tiago,
I couldn't reproduce the AV and since build 11 is arriving, maybe this is already fixed or if not, let's wait to see if Tim can confirm this. I can however answer the other questions: > 2. How to reach created TEMPORARY TABLE? EXPORT TEMPORARY TABLE TODAYS_LOG > TO ... is not correct It's simply EXPORT TABLE , just like any other table. Appart from the fact that temporary tables are only visible to the current session and some restrictions on DDL statement that can be used, after created a temporary table is treated exacly the same way as if it was not temporary. > 3. How to delete it when script terminates? DROP TABLE TODAYS_LOG You can drop it from the script, just after exporting. -- Fernando Dias [Team Elevate] |

Tim Young [Elevate Software] Elevate Software, Inc. timyoung@elevatesoft.com | Tiago,
<< 1. Server raises: ElevateDB Error #900 An error occurred with the statement at line 7 and column 1 (Access violation at address 00000000. Write of address 00000000) >> That happens when you try to create a temporary table when the active database is the Configuration database. If you select a valid user-defined database, it will work okay. A fix will be in B11 so that a proper error message is raised that prevents you from trying to create a temporary table in the Configuration database. << 2. How to reach created TEMPORARY TABLE? EXPORT TEMPORARY TABLE TODAYS_LOG TO ... is not correct >> Just use EXPORT TABLE - leave off the TEMPORARY. -- Tim Young Elevate Software www.elevatesoft.com |
